func extractZIP(zipFile, destDir string) error {
r, err := zip.OpenReader(zipFile)
if err != nil {
return err
}
defer r.Close()
if err := os.MkdirAll(destDir, 0755); err != nil {
return err
}
for _, f := range r.File {
err := extractFile(f, destDir)
if err != nil {
return err
}
}
return nil
}
func extractFile(f *zip.File, destDir string) error {
rc, err := f.Open()
if err != nil {
return err
}
defer rc.Close()
path := filepath.Join(destDir, f.Name)
out, err := os.OpenFile(path, os.O_WRONLY|os.O_CREATE|os.O_TRUNC, f.Mode())
if err != nil {
return err
}
defer out.Close()
_, err = io.Copy(out, rc)
return err
}
